Third day (Sunday) Free day or optional excursions to Fruska gora and Novi Sad
Breakfast. Free day for individual tourism. OPTIONAL: Excursion. We will pass through Fruška Gora National Park, which, in addition to its natural beauty, also hides a large number of Serbian Orthodox monasteries, earning it the nickname "Sacred Mountain of Serbia" (37 monasteries were built, 19 are still active today). We will stop to visit the monasteries of Novo Hopovo (15th century) and Krušedol (16th century). We will visit Sremski Karlovci, a small village of great historical importance (the signing of the Peace of Karlovci, where round tables were first used in negotiations so that no one would have more importance at the table). A walk through Karlovci: the oldest institute in Serbia, the Four Lions Fountain, the Patriarch’s Summer Palace. Wine tasting at one of the local wineries (we will taste the "Bermet" wine, which is the only one from this region that was served on the Titanic). The next stop is the Petrovaradin Fortress, with an exceptional view of Novi Sad. Arrival in Novi Sad (the second-largest city in Serbia) and a sightseeing tour of the city center: Freedom Square and the City Hall, Dunavska and Zmaj Jovina Streets, Catholic and Orthodox churches, synagogue, theater.
